Clean Seas Seafood Ltd (CSS) has a Tangible Net Worth Ratio of 99.6% as of December 2024. This metric is calculated by deducting intangible assets (AU$109.00K) from net assets (AU$29.34 Million) and expressing it as a percentage of total net assets. A higher ratio means that more of the company's equity is backed by tangible, balance-sheet-verifiable assets rather than goodwill, patents, or brand value.
